Ingredients
For the Chicken Filling
- 2 large chicken breasts (cooked and shredded)
- 2 tablespoons butter
- ½ tablespoons olive oil
- ½ cup Franks Red Hot Wing Sauce
- ½ teaspoon celery seed
- fresh pepper to taste
- ½ cup thinly sliced celery
For Assembly
- blue cheese crumbles
- ranch dressing
- 2 heads of lettuce (romaine or iceberg, rinsed and patted dry)
How to Make Buffalo Chicken Lettuce Wraps
Step 1: Cook the Chicken
- In a large skillet, add the chicken breasts along with 1/2 cup of water over medium/high heat.
- Use two forks to shred the chicken as it cooks until all the water evaporates.
Step 2: Prepare the Saucy Mixture
- Lower the heat to medium/low and add butter and olive oil to the pan.
- Stir until melted and combined smoothly.
- Add hot sauce, celery seed, and fresh pepper to taste. Mix well.
- Remove from heat and stir in the thinly sliced celery.
Step 3: Assemble Your Wraps
- Scoop a spoonful of the buffalo chicken mixture into each lettuce leaf.
- Sprinkle with blue cheese crumbles and drizzle with ranch dressing.
- Serve immediately while warm for maximum flavor!

How to Perfect Buffalo Chicken Lettuce Wraps
Creating the perfect buffalo chicken lettuce wraps is all about balance and flavor. Here are some tips to elevate your dish.
- Bold Sauce Choice: Opt for Frank’s Red Hot Wing Sauce as it offers just the right amount of heat without overpowering.
- Fresh Ingredients: Use fresh celery and herbs to enhance crunchiness and flavor.
- Texture Matters: Consider adding crunchy toppings like crushed tortilla chips or nuts for an added layer of texture.
- Experiment with Lettuce Types: While romaine and iceberg are classic choices, try butter lettuce for a softer wrap that holds moisture better.
- Make Ahead Options: Prepare the chicken mix ahead of time and store it in the fridge. Assemble just before serving for maximum freshness.

Common Mistakes to Avoid
Creating Buffalo Chicken Lettuce Wraps can be simple, but certain mistakes can affect the final outcome. Here are common pitfalls to watch out for:
- Using Undercooked Chicken: Ensure your chicken is fully cooked before shredding. Undercooked chicken can lead to food safety issues.
- Skipping the Seasoning: Don’t forget to add enough hot sauce and spices! A bland mix will not give you that authentic buffalo flavor.
- Overstuffing the Lettuce Wraps: Fill your lettuce leaves moderately. Overstuffing can make them difficult to handle and eat.
- Choosing the Wrong Lettuce: Not all lettuce works well for wraps. Avoid leafy varieties that tear easily; opt for sturdy romaine or iceberg.
- Serving Cold: Serve your buffalo chicken warm for the best flavor and texture. Cold wraps can lose their appeal.
Refrigerator Storage
- Store leftovers in an airtight container in the fridge.
- They will last up to 3 days.
Freezing Buffalo Chicken Lettuce Wraps
- Place cooled chicken mixture in a freezer-safe container or bag.
- These wraps can be frozen for up to 2 months.
Reheating Buffalo Chicken Lettuce Wraps
- Oven: Preheat oven to 350°F (175°C) and heat for about 10-15 minutes until warmed through.
- Microwave: Heat in 30-second intervals until warmed, but avoid making the lettuce soggy.
- Stovetop: Gently reheat in a pan over low heat, stirring occasionally to maintain moisture.
Frequently Asked Questions
What are Buffalo Chicken Lettuce Wraps?
Buffalo Chicken Lettuce Wraps are a healthier alternative to traditional buffalo wings. They feature shredded chicken tossed in spicy buffalo sauce, served in crisp lettuce leaves.
Can I make these Buffalo Chicken Lettuce Wraps ahead of time?
Yes! You can prepare the shredded chicken mixture ahead of time and store it in the refrigerator. Assemble just before serving for the freshest taste.
How spicy are Buffalo Chicken Lettuce Wraps?
The spice level depends on how much hot sauce you use. Adjust it according to your preference by adding more or less sauce.
What can I substitute for blue cheese crumbles?
If blue cheese isn’t your favorite, try feta cheese or omit it entirely. You could also use a dairy-free cheese option if desired.
Are Buffalo Chicken Lettuce Wraps gluten-free?
Yes, they can be gluten-free if you ensure that all sauces and dressings used are labeled as such.
